๐๐จ ๐ฒ๐จ๐ฎ ๐ค๐ง๐จ๐ฐ ๐๐๐ญ๐๐ซ ๐๐ซ๐ข๐ง๐๐ข๐ฉ๐ฅ๐?
I knew a star sales rep who earned a well-deserved promotion to sales manager. But suddenly, the skills that made her a top performer were not enough. Coaching, leading, and strategizing, skills she had never been trained for, became towering obstacles. Without the right support, she struggled, and her team suffered. ๐๐ก๐ ๐ฆ๐จ๐ฌ๐ญ ๐ฎ๐ง๐๐๐ซ๐ซ๐๐ญ๐๐ ๐ฌ๐ค๐ข๐ฅ๐ฅ ๐ข๐ง ๐ฅ๐๐๐๐๐ซ๐ฌ๐ก๐ข๐ฉ ๐ข๐ฌ๐งโ๐ญ ๐ฌ๐ญ๐ซ๐๐ญ๐๐ ๐ฒ. ๐๐ญโ๐ฌ ๐๐ซ๐๐๐ญ๐ข๐ง๐ ๐ฌ๐ฉ๐๐๐ ๐๐จ๐ซ ๐จ๐ญ๐ก๐๐ซ๐ฌ ๐ญ๐จ ๐ซ๐ข๐ฌ๐.
Iโve seen CEOs and executives transform their organizations not by being the smartest person in the room, but by being the leader who: -Listens when others feel invisible. -Creates safety for people to challenge ideas. -Invests time in developing leaders who, in turn, grow others. -Celebrates wins that arenโt their own.
